Shares of Coinbase have fallen around 45% after reporting earnings alongside a similar-sized fall in crypto’s total market cap, due to expectations of higher interest rates and the sell-off in “longer duration, high growth related assets,” Goldman Sachs said in a research note published on Wednesday.
